This was a problem early on -- there was a driver timing bug with the V30 which AT&T wouldn't fix because the V30 "was not a supported device." There was an internal AT&T only version of the driver that worked with the V30 which was never shipped. I hear the AST V4.0 Lim driver works fine with the V30 and the AT&T card.
